from __future__ import annotations

from tradingview_screener.query import Query, DEFAULT_RANGE, URL


def stocks(market: str = 'america') -> Query:
    """
    Screener for stocks (common, preferred, DRs, and non-ETF funds), filtered to primary listings
    only and sorted by market cap descending.

    :param market: Market/country to scan, e.g. ``'america'``, ``'italy'``, ``'germany'``.
        Defaults to ``'america'``.
    """
    return Query(market)


def coin() -> Query:
    """
    Screener for crypto coins (CoinMarketCap universe), sorted by overall rank ascending.
    """
    q = Query()
    q.url = URL.format(market='coin')
    q.query = {
        'markets': ['coin'],
        'symbols': {},
        'options': {'lang': 'en'},
        'columns': [
            'ticker-view',
            'crypto_total_rank',
            'close',
            'type',
            'typespecs',
            'pricescale',
            'minmov',
            'fractional',
            'minmove2',
            'currency',
            '24h_close_change|5',
            'market_cap_calc',
            'fundamental_currency_code',
            '24h_vol_cmc',
            'circulating_supply',
            '24h_vol_to_market_cap',
            'socialdominance',
            'crypto_common_categories.tr',
            'TechRating_1D',
            'TechRating_1D.tr',
        ],
        'sort': {'sortBy': 'crypto_total_rank', 'sortOrder': 'asc'},
        'range': DEFAULT_RANGE.copy(),
        'ignore_unknown_fields': False,
    }
    return q


def crypto() -> Query:
    """
    Screener for centralised-exchange (CEX) crypto pairs, sorted by 24 h volume descending.
    """
    q = Query()
    q.url = URL.format(market='crypto')
    q.query = {
        'markets': ['crypto'],
        'symbols': {},
        'options': {'lang': 'en'},
        'columns': [
            'ticker-view',
            'exchange.tr',
            'provider-id',
            'close',
            'type',
            'typespecs',
            'pricescale',
            'minmov',
            'fractional',
            'minmove2',
            'currency',
            '24h_close_change|5',
            '24h_vol|5',
            '24h_vol_change|5',
            'TechRating_1D',
            'TechRating_1D.tr',
        ],
        'filter2': {
            'operator': 'and',
            'operands': [
                {'expression': {'left': 'centralization', 'operation': 'equal', 'right': 'cex'}}
            ],
        },
        'sort': {'sortBy': '24h_vol|5', 'sortOrder': 'desc'},
        'range': DEFAULT_RANGE.copy(),
        'ignore_unknown_fields': False,
    }
    return q

def forex() -> Query:
    """
    Screener for forex currency pairs, sorted by traded value descending.
    """
    q = Query()
    q.url = URL.format(market='forex')
    q.query = {
        'markets': ['forex'],
        'symbols': {},
        'options': {'lang': 'en'},
        'columns': ['name', 'close', 'volume', 'currency'],
        'sort': {'sortBy': 'Value.Traded', 'sortOrder': 'desc'},
        'range': DEFAULT_RANGE.copy(),
        'ignore_unknown_fields': False,
    }
    return q


def futures() -> Query:
    """
    Screener for futures contracts, sorted by traded value descending.
    """
    q = Query()
    q.url = URL.format(market='futures')
    q.query = {
        'markets': ['futures'],
        'symbols': {},
        'options': {'lang': 'en'},
        'columns': ['name', 'close', 'volume', 'currency'],
        'sort': {'sortBy': 'Value.Traded', 'sortOrder': 'desc'},
        'range': DEFAULT_RANGE.copy(),
        'ignore_unknown_fields': False,
    }
    return q


def bond() -> Query:
    """
    Screener for bonds, sorted by S&P long-term rating descending.
    """
    q = Query()
    q.url = URL.format(market='bond')
    q.query = {
        'markets': ['bond'],
        'symbols': {},
        'options': {'lang': 'en'},
        'columns': [
            'ticker-view',
            'exchange.tr',
            'source-logoid',
            'isin-displayed',
            'yield_to_worst',
            'close_pct',
            'close_net',
            'type',
            'typespecs',
            'fundamental_currency_code',
            'current_coupon',
            'maturity_date',
            'redemption_type.tr',
            'bond_issuer_type.tr',
            'bond_snp_rating_lt.tr',
            'bond_fitch_rating_lt.tr',
        ],
        'sort': {'sortBy': 'bond_snp_rating_lt', 'sortOrder': 'desc'},
        'range': DEFAULT_RANGE.copy(),
        'ignore_unknown_fields': False,
    }
    return q
